Hans-Kristian Arntzen
32f7ff2c20 wsi/x11: Fix present ID signal when IDLE comes before COMPLETE.
It appears to be possible that IDLE is observed before COMPLETE.
In this case, an application may access present_id in subsequent
QueuePresentKHR and race against the fence worker reading present_id.

Solve this by adding a separate signal_present_id that is used when
completing to avoid the race.

Lionel Landwerlin
d4a2c0fcaa vulkan/wsi: add a headless swapchain implementation/option
I wanted to find slow pieces of code in our Anv driver using our
drm-shim stub.

The last bit of code still talking to the compositor was the WSI
swapchain code and failing because none of the submissions are taking
place (because of the stub).

This change introduces a new variable MESA_VK_WSI_HEADLESS_SWAPCHAIN
which when set turns every swapchain creation into a headless
swapchain. This swapchain does not present anything, allowing the
application to spin as many frames as possible. Thus helping to
identify slow spots in command buffer building path.
